I, the Executioner is a 2024 is the sequel to his 2015 film Veteran (2015).

Veteran detective Seo Do-cheol (Hwang Jung-min), who battles crime day and night without time to take care of his own family, is part of the Violent Crimes Investigation Unit. One day, the death of a professor is revealed to be connected to previous murder cases, causing a nationwide commotion over a serial killer. As the detectives begin their investigation, following the clues, the serial killer seemingly mocks them by releasing a teaser on the internet, announcing the next target, further unsettling the entire country. The Violent Crimes Investigation Unit brings in Park Sun-woo (Jung Hae-in), a young detective full of a sense of justice who has caught Seo Do-cheol's eye. The case then takes a new direction...

Directed by Ryoo Seung-wan
Presented in Korean with English Subtitles
